Dan Peer
Professor Dan Peer is a prominent researcher and the director of the Laboratory of Precision NanoMedicine at Tel Aviv University. He co-led a groundbreaking study that developed a new mRNA vaccine providing 100% protection against pneumonic plague, a severe and highly lethal infection caused by the bacterium Yersinia pestis.
